Transaction 5d31d4158fae2299048eccf80ab439dee9c0dcde45a4f6fcba0502dcd260af90
1 Input
1 Output
-
5d31d4158fae2299048eccf80ab439dee9c0dcde45a4f6fcba0502dcd260af90:0
- value
- 509463
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2225e8f234e51bd2f4ccd5450e86dfdc1d685ee2 OP_EQUAL
- address
- 34oaK6UW2Pmz2B7zhbvTkdxnXo6XtVS3A5